I have never played IJN myself, but in GBs I always encounter Yammy or SY as my opponent, and they look pretty much the same to me. How do one distinguish between the two?

It is kinda important to BB player like me, because I will need to know what kind of strategy I would use against him.

LILITALY5179
I don't really find it difficult to identify any ship in the game. The Yammy has light greenish/blue on the bow and stern. The SY has bright forrest green instead ont he bow, stern, and sides of the hull. Biggest thing I look for is that color difference. The SY's hull is bright forrest green, where the Yammy's is silver/gray. Big hint.

Vlad381
The SY has green bits of camouflage which partly cover the deck, and which you can see on the sides of the superstructure even if the angle is head on. Also, if he's running in a straight line he's a noob anyway, you should watch him turn because he should be zig-zagging.

But yes the SY should basically have a green deck front and back, the Yammy is silver.

Invinciblor
I rely heavily on damage point numbers at the start to recognize ship tiers, personally.

If it starts with 26k DP, it's the Yamato. If it looks like it's got more than 30k, definitely SY.

KingCong
you can use the ranking medal sometimes

if 3 gold bar or no medal, then BO lvl < 100, thus Yammy

if bronze medal, than could be high lvl yammy or low lvl SY

if silver or gold medal, then most likely SY or rarely a formidable player with high lvl crew back on Yammy

I usually dont judge players based on lvl or win percentage since there are low lvl prodigies / ebve as well as BB5/6 who cant aim for beans but it provides a first impression.
